One of Ohio's Most Beautiful Beetles: Dogbane Beetle

One of Ohio's Most Beautiful Beetles: Dogbane Beetle

Dogbane Beetles (Chrysochus auratus) are truly Nature’s eye candy. The same beetle will present a kaleidoscope of colors when viewed at different angles to the sun. They are arguably one of the most beautiful beetles found in Ohio. Their light-blending artistry makes these shimmering living gems stand out on the dark green foliage of their […]
